Bride by Contract: A practical marriage becomes a partnership of hearts

A ruined viscount's daughter. A self-made magnate. A marriage contract that was supposed to save a family-not awaken a heart.

With creditors at the door and the unentailed Vaughn home days from seizure, Isabel Vaughn is out of time. Responsible for her three sisters and an ailing mother, she agrees to the only practical offer on the table: a marriage of convenience to William Rothwell, a wealthy shipping merchant who needs a high-born wife to ease his path into society.

The terms are clear-Isabel's breeding and social grace in exchange for William's promise to settle every debt and provide dowries for her sisters. Separate bedrooms. Polite distance. No expectations.

But London has a way of unmaking tidy bargains. Isabel's quick mind for numbers proves invaluable to William's empire; ledger talks turn into late nights and genuine partnership. A kiss meant to be a mistake becomes a promise neither of them saw coming. And just as trust begins to take root, a scandal from William's past resurfaces, threatening to brand her a fool and him a fraud-destroying the very future they're quietly building.

Now the viscount's daughter who bartered herself for her family's survival must decide if she'll fight for a marriage no contract can contain. And the man who "bought" his way into society must prove he can earn the only thing that matters: his wife's heart.
